What Exactly is Rolled Cargo in Shipping?
Rolled cargo happens when freight can't board its scheduled vessel due to space limits. In 2025, this logistics issue hits hard amid surging global trade volumes.
Carriers overbook like airlines to fill ships, but when demand exceeds capacity, cargo gets rolled to later sailings.
- Common in peak seasons like Q4 holidays
- Affects containerized and bulk freight
- Leads to 7-14 day delays typically
Top 7 Causes of Rolled Cargo in 2025 Logistics
Understanding rolled cargo causes helps logistics pros anticipate issues in today's tight market.
2025 brings new pressures from national capacity changes—no major WCO revisions until 2027, but regional rules spike rolls.
- Persistent vessel capacity shortages: Demand outstrips fleet growth 7% yearly
- Shifted peak seasons from e-commerce surges
- AI booking glitches creating overcommitments
- 2025 environmental regs slowing speeds
- Geopolitical route disruptions (e.g., Red Sea alternatives)
- Port congestion from labor and infrastructure lags
- Overbooking practices by ocean carriers

How to Prevent Rolled Cargo: 2025 Step-by-Step Guide
**Proactive prevention beats reactive fixes for rolled cargo in modern logistics.**
- Book 4-6 weeks early: Secure space before peaks
- Monitor capacity via real-time tools
- Diversify carriers across 2-3 options
- Use predictive analytics for trends
- Opt for flexible contracts with roll protections
